Forbes Travel Guide rounded up the city’s best hotels to ensure your stay is as memorable as the city itself. You can trust FTG’s exclusive list — we have been rating hotels since 1958 using an objective and independent process.
To find the best hotels in New Orleans, our incognito inspectors posed as ordinary guests and stayed multiple nights at each property. The inspectors tested hundreds of exacting standards, with an emphasis on exceptional service, which accounts for 70% of a property’s rating. The remaining 30% comes from the quality and condition of the facilities.
FTG does not require a business relationship from the properties it rates, and it does not earn a commission if you book one of the following hotels.
